The Growing Importance of Elderly Care at Home


Aging brings with it several health challenges such as chronic conditions, reduced mobility, memory issues, and increased vulnerability to infections. Hospitals are not always the ideal setting for long-term care, especially for seniors who thrive better in familiar surroundings. That's where in-home medical monitoring steps in—it allows trained professionals to keep a watchful eye on a senior’s health while ensuring their comfort and dignity are preserved.


With the help of home-based health services, families in Bangalore can now access customized care plans. These are tailored to meet the medical needs of the elderly, covering everything from routine check-ups and medication management to emergency response systems and regular health tracking.



Real-Time Health Tracking for Early Intervention


One of the most significant advantages of in-home medical monitoring is early detection. By continuously tracking vital signs like blood pressure, oxygen levels, heart rate, and temperature, caregivers can identify any unusual changes before they become severe. For instance, a slight increase in blood sugar levels or a drop in oxygen saturation can be quickly addressed before it leads to hospitalization.


Advanced digital tools, such as wearable devices and remote monitoring systems, allow nurses and doctors to stay updated in real time. This is particularly useful for seniors with conditions like diabetes, hypertension, or cardiac issues, where regular monitoring is crucial.



Medication Management and Adherence


One of the most common challenges among elderly patients is remembering to take medications on time. Missed doses or incorrect medication use can lead to complications and setbacks in recovery. In-home nursing services offer medication support that includes timely reminders, dosage management, and checking for side effects or adverse reactions.


Trained nurses are equipped to manage even complex medication schedules, ensuring that the patient remains consistent in their treatment. For seniors with dementia or cognitive difficulties, this level of supervision is vital for maintaining stability and avoiding medical emergencies.



Reducing the Risk of Falls and Injuries


Seniors are more prone to slips, trips, and falls, especially when mobility is limited. In-home nurses can assess the living environment for potential hazards and implement safety measures, such as grab bars in bathrooms, clutter-free walkways, and slip-resistant rugs.


Additionally, nurses assist with daily tasks like bathing, dressing, and walking, reducing the risk of injury. This hands-on help not only keeps seniors safe but also empowers them to live more independently within their own home.



Emotional and Social Well-being


While physical health is critical, emotional and mental well-being are equally important. Seniors who live alone often face isolation and loneliness, which can lead to depression or anxiety. Having a professional nurse or caregiver visit regularly brings companionship and emotional comfort.


Moreover, many home nurses are trained not only in medical care but also in offering psychosocial support. They engage in meaningful conversations, offer encouragement, and even participate in light physical activities or hobbies with the elderly, contributing to a higher quality of life.



Emergency Preparedness and Quick Response


In case of a sudden health deterioration or accident, having a skilled professional on-site or on-call can make all the difference. Home nurses are trained to recognize emergency symptoms and take immediate action, whether it’s providing first aid, using a medical device, or contacting emergency medical services.


Their presence ensures that no time is lost, especially in conditions like strokes, heart attacks, or diabetic emergencies where every second counts. This kind of reassurance is incredibly valuable to families, particularly those who live away from their elderly parents.



Customized and Continuous Care Plans


In-home care allows for the creation of a personalized health management plan that evolves with the patient’s needs. From daily monitoring to periodic physician reviews, the entire care cycle can be coordinated and documented, ensuring continuity.


This kind of comprehensive, customized approach is difficult to achieve in institutional settings. Home-based care allows adjustments to be made quickly based on health changes, ensuring the patient always receives the most appropriate and effective treatment.
